Yasue Yamada is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ience and Genetics. According to data from OpenAlex, Yasue Yamada has authored 26 papers receiving a total of 403 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Molecular Biology, 6 papers in Cellular and Molecular Neuroscience and 5 papers in Genetics. Recurrent topics in Yasue Yamada’s work include Neuroscience and Neuropharmacology Research (5 papers), Iron-based superconductors research (5 papers) and Ion channel regulation and function (5 papers). Yasue Yamada is often cited by papers focused on Neuroscience and Neuropharmacology Research (5 papers), Iron-based superconductors research (5 papers) and Ion channel regulation and function (5 papers). Yasue Yamada collaborates with scholars based in Japan and United States. Yasue Yamada's co-authors include Kenji Sobue, Makoto Inui, Mamoru Yamada, Yasuyo Chochi, Milton H. Saier, Yoshifumi Watanabe, Takashi Iwamoto, Atsushi Nakazawa, Y. Kitaoka and Sachiye Inouye and has published in prestigious journals such as Journal of Biological Chemistry, Physical Review B and Biochemical and Biophysical Research Communications.
